### 1. Understanding Liquidation & Margin

Before discussing stop-losses, grasping liquidation and margin is essential. Liquidation occurs when your position's margin falls below the maintenance margin level, forcing the exchange to automatically close your position to prevent further losses. This happens *regardless* of your stop-loss order if your margin is insufficient to cover the adverse price movement.

### 5. Quantitative Approaches & Backtesting

Advanced traders often employ quantitative strategies. Backtesting (testing your strategy on historical data) is crucial to validate your stop-loss parameters. This involves defining clear entry and exit rules, including stop-loss levels, and analyzing the historical performance of the strategy.

Proper stop-loss implementation isn’t about avoiding losses altogether; it's about *controlling* those losses and protecting your capital for future opportunities. Continuously refining your strategies and adapting to market conditions is vital for long-term success in crypto futures trading.
